JUST BOUGHT A JINMA 404 WITH A HUNDRED HOURS ON THE CLOCK . DON.T KNOW IF THE FACTORY FLUIDS WERE EVER DUMPED , HAVE HEARD THEY SHOULD BE . ANY OPINIONS ON THE SUBJECT ?
 
/ FLUIDS DUMP #2  
With 400 hours, all the fluids should be changed, regardless of whether they're factory or after-market. Cheap protection. Also, adjust clutch, tighten all bolts, adjust valve lash and re-torque the head gasket.

THANX FOR REPLY. GOT A HANDLE ON MOST OF THE FLUID CHANGE , BUT THE INJECTOR PUMP FLUID CHANGE . ????
 
/ FLUIDS DUMP #5  
Drain bolt on the bottom of most of them, if not you may have to suck it out with a squeeze bulb. Fill to the dipstick mark with engine oil. You fill it either through the dipstick or the mushroom-shaped cap on the top. If the drain bolt is on one side/end there may be a bolt directly above it that is the witness hole - pull that bolt and fill with new fluid until it weeps out the upper bolt then button things up.
